Javascript Flask cookies在Postman中设置,但不在浏览器中设置
我对烧瓶饼干有问题,我的路线是在邮递员工作,但当我试图测试我的前端,我的饼干没有设置 这是我连接用户的路径:Javascript Flask cookies在Postman中设置,但不在浏览器中设置,javascript,python,flask,cookies,Javascript,Python,Flask,Cookies,我对烧瓶饼干有问题,我的路线是在邮递员工作,但当我试图测试我的前端,我的饼干没有设置 这是我连接用户的路径: @users.route('/api/user/login', methods=['POST']) def check_password(): req = request.get_json() email = req['email'] password = req['password'] query = Users().get_by_email(email
@users.route('/api/user/login', methods=['POST'])
def check_password():
req = request.get_json()
email = req['email']
password = req['password']
query = Users().get_by_email(email)
if query:
if bcrypt.check_password_hash(query['password'], password):
res = make_response("Vous êtes connecté")
res.set_cookie('status', 'connected', max_age=60 * 60 * 24 * 365 * 2, domain='127.0.0.1')
session.modified = True
return res
else:
return "Password incorect"
else:
return "Pas d'utilisateur"
这是我检查用户状态的途径(以了解是否设置了cookie):
这是我前面的AJAX请求,用于调用我的路线:
userStatus() {
$.ajax({
method: "GET",
url: "http://localhost:8080/api/user/status",
})
.done((data) => {
console.log(data);
})
.fail(() => {
console.log("PAS OK")
})
}
如果有人能帮我解决这个问题,那就太好了。
谢谢大家!
userStatus() {
$.ajax({
method: "GET",
url: "http://localhost:8080/api/user/status",
})
.done((data) => {
console.log(data);
})
.fail(() => {
console.log("PAS OK")
})
}